How Many People Are Named Shalin?

An estimated 492 people in the United States have the first name Shalin. It is used for both genders, with 65.9% male. The average bearer is 30 years old, and Shalin peaked in popularity in 1977 with 22 births that year.

Gender Distribution for Shalin

Shalin is a genuinely unisex name, used for both males (65.9%) and females (34.1%). Out of 508 total births registered, 335 were male and 173 were female.

Shalin: Popularity Over Time

SSA records for Shalin span from the 1970s to the 2020s, covering 6 decades of naming data. The most popular decade for this name was the 2000s, when 152 babies were registered. Shalin has declined significantly from its peak in the 2000s. Recent registrations are a fraction of what they were at the name's height.

Where does this data come from?

Our estimates use Social Security Administration birth records (1880 to 2024), adjusted for survival using CDC 2023 life tables broken down by sex. The U.S. population figure (342,754,338) is from the Census Bureau's July 2025 estimate. Full methodology.
